[. . . ] Switch your TV set's input to match the type of video used for the currently selected source. Step 6. Region Selection: Set the Region Selector to "K" for South Korea. Set it to "S" for Singapore, Malaysia, Indonesia or Thailand. (For other countries, please consult your local JBL distributor. ) The Main Power Switch (not just Standby) must be turned off, then on again, in order for this selection to take effect (see page 35). Depending on the electrical requirements in your area, you may need to contact your JBL dealer to obtain the correct power cord. Select digital inputs: If your DVD is connected to Coax 1, no adjustment is needed. For any other digital-device connections, use the front-panel Digital Select button and the arrow buttons to select an optical or coax digital input (see pages 22 and 32). Select a surround mode: Press the Surround Mode button on the front panel to select Dolby ® Pro Logic ® II ­ Movie. (You may select other modes later as you become familiar with the AVR580; see pages 22­24 and 31­35. ) Step 10.
